Runbook: date localization for Thistleport plugins. Always format dates through the host's locale API — never roll your own patterns. Detect locale from the session context, fall back to ISO 8601. Test against the RTL and non-Gregorian fixtures before publishing. Formatting previews are served by the Larkmill render service; plugin authors authenticate to it with the key below.

gateway credential: zpat4_626B

## Break-Glass: Orpine Hall Seat-Map Renderer

Scope: emergency admin access to the seat-map renderer serving Orpine Hall box office. Normal deploys go through the Stagecraft pipeline; break-glass is for renderer outages during on-sale events only.

Controls: dual approval from duty lead and box-office manager, full session recording, 24h access expiry. Reviewer note: audit trail lives in the ops ledger. The emergency console unseals with the recovery passphrase below.

unlock words, hahip-baduf: holwyn-istath-julvan

**Runbook: read-replica lag alarm (Saltmere DB)**

If the Saltmere replica lag alarm fires, don't panic — it's usually the nightly export hogging the primary. Check lag trend first: flat and under five minutes means wait it out. Climbing steadily means page the data team and fail reads over to the secondary replica.

Log the incident with the trace token printed below.

pipeline stamp: htk6_7941f2